Transaction d6638e1eef20d612253a3848fbd2152b1b956078f1a43c72293fc0239f6ce1bf
1 Input
1 Output
-
d6638e1eef20d612253a3848fbd2152b1b956078f1a43c72293fc0239f6ce1bf:0
- value
- 84670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c923a66928df032af7f161079e37e9d02a75e681 OP_EQUAL
- address
- 3L2YT7LMdxGm1BZe1W7kuJB5o1zBh8LVLo